Whether any individual dies because of poverty is more difficult to state, but you can look at the mortality rates for people of different incomes and there will always be a gap. For those that think that only absolute poverty is important, that is wrong. Relative povery is very important. The US has one of the widest gaps between rich and poor in the developed world, and it also has one of the poorest records as regards health (and other) problems related to poverty in the developed world - including infant mortality figures. The correlation is pretty strong. Even within the US - when comparing states - the important figure linked to these problems is not the overall wealth of the state, but rather the size of the gap between rich and poor - ie the level of inequality.
